#P8297. [COCI2012-2013#2] LANCI

[COCI2012-2013#2] LANCI

题目背景

本题分值按 COCI 原题设置,满分 100100

题目描述

Mirko 在阁楼里发现了 NN 个链。每个链由一些节组成,其中每个节最多有两个相邻节。每个节都可以打开或合上,因此可以将链分开或连成更长的链。

Mirko 希望把所有链连成一条巨大的链,并且打开或合上尽可能少的节。

例如,假设 Mirko 只有 33 个链,每个链只有一个节,他可以打开其中一个,并且连上另外两个再合上。

给定链的数量以及每个链的长度,找到 Mirko 必须打开和关闭的最小节数,使它们全部在一个长链上。

输入格式

第一行一个整数 N (2N5×105)N\ (2\le N\le 5\times 10^5),表示链的数量。

第二行 NN 个正整数 Li (1Li106)L_i\ (1\le L_i\le 10^6),表示第 ii 个链的长度。

输出格式

输出仅一行一个整数,表示最少要打开的节数。

2
3 3
1
3
1 1 1
1
5
4 3 5 7 9
3